YFC South Asia held an ASPIRE conference in May ‘18. ASPIRE stands for “Asia Pacific In Relational Evangelism.” This bi-annual conference, not held since 2018 due to Covid, fosters a strong YFC future through training, collaboration and spiritual challenge. The 2022 ASPIRE targeted over 60 Young Leaders, emphasizing leadership and evangelism ministry methodologies training, also was planned to comfort and encourage YFC staff after some very hard pandemic years. The theme, therefore, was “Christ: Our Strength, Hope, and Refuge.” Planning the conference almost entirely through Zoom meetings was a challenge, but our host nation Nepal did a great job filling in gaps and Bangladesh brought expertise to ensure things ran smoothly.
